• Пропало создание сжатой ZIP папки. Как вернуть?

    @AUser0
    Чем больше знаю, тем лучше понимаю, как мало знаю.
    Со страницы Restore Default Apps for File Type Associations in... скачиваете файл zip.reg, дважды щелкаете по нему, соглашаетесь с изменениями в реестре, всё. Останется только выйти и зайти под пользователем (или просто перезагрузить компьютер) - и вуаля, интеграция ZIP восстановлена!
    Ответ написан
    2 комментария
  • Как из браузера выгрузить всю страницу целиком?

    @risejs
    Нет никакой защиты, есть люди которые не умеют пользоваться браузером. Один скриптом отключает нажатие Ctrl+S и ПКМ на своем сайте, и думает что защита. Другой не может нажать Ctrl+S и ПКМ на чужом сайте, и думает что защита. Оба не знают что страницу можно сохранить через меню в правом верхнем углу.

    Контент не статичен. Страница загружается в одном виде (смотри Ctrl+U), и может преобразоваться скриптами в другой (смотри DevTools). Например, таблица подгружается частями, в зависимости от действий пользователя (прокрутка, пагинация, и тп), потому что в ней миллион строк и контента на 100 МБ.

    Поэтому (Chrome):
    1. Правый верхний угол > Дополнительные инструменты > Сохранить страницу как...
    2. Тип файла > "Веб-страница полностью" / "Веб-страница, только HTML" / "Веб-страница, один файл"
    Ответ написан
    3 комментария
  • Как запретить загрузку с LiveCD?

    CityCat4
    @CityCat4
    Внимание! Изменился адрес почты!
    Убрать приводы советовать не буду :) - их и так ни у кого уже нет. Можно заблокировать USB-порты. Причем не программными какими-то там блокировщиками - а тупо - заклеить бумажкой с печатью. Да, от вставки не защитит. Но сразу, как только "дефлорация" будет замечена - ответственный юзер получает люлей (даже если это и не он был).

    Как всегда комбинация административных и технических методов.
    Ответ написан
    Комментировать
  • Как с помощью python загружать данные на страницу?

    @AndreiPy13
    Да, верно, используй Selenium. Можно и нажимать(click) и вставлять данные(send_keys) и многое другое.
    Для простого определения селектора можно в браузере кликнуть пкм на элемент и copy -> css selector.
    В гугле много инфы, рекомендую сразу почитать и про Page Object)
    Я когда-то с этого курса начинал изучение selenium https://stepik.org/course/575/promo

    Простой пример(не забудьте скачать драйвер для Chrome):

    from selenium import webdriver
    from selenium.webdriver.common.by import By
    from selenium.webdriver.support.ui import WebDriverWait
    from selenium.webdriver.support import expected_conditions as EC
    
    driver = webdriver.Chrome()  # Здесь используется Chrome WebDriver. Вы можете использовать другие веб-драйверы, в зависимости от вашего браузера.
    driver.get("http://www.example.com")  # Замените "http://www.example.com" на URL вашей веб-страницы.
    button = driver.find_element(By.ID, "my-button")  # Замените "my-button" на значение атрибута id вашей кнопки.
    button.click() # Выполните клик на кнопку
    driver.quit() # Закройте веб-драйвер после завершения работы
    Ответ написан
    1 комментарий
  • Какое оборудование нужно для снятия панорам?

    vabka
    @vabka
    Токсичный шарпист
    Если качественные панорамы, то штатив + камера.
    Если туры в квартиры или любительского уровня панорамы на улице (для видео или подобия google streets view) - любая 360-камера.
    Если панорамы уровня google streets view, то оборудование там соответствующее и не подпадает под категорию "Хочу начать".

    Если ультра бюджетно - телефон с нормальной камерой + приложение для снятия панорам.

    3d тут не причём.
    Ответ написан
    3 комментария
  • Можно ли перенести диск с Linux(Ubuntu) на другое устройство?

    CityCat4
    @CityCat4
    Внимание! Изменился адрес почты!
    Сильно другой ноут - могут быть проблемы - различные дрова на wifi, тач, батарейку. Ноут примерно одной серии или хотя бы одного производителя - проблемы могут быть, но меньше.
    Два одинаковых ноута - вообще без проблем :)
    Ответ написан
    Комментировать
  • Что за экшен для фотошопа?

    pozZzitiv
    @pozZzitiv Куратор тега Adobe Photoshop
    Дизайнер и перфекционист
    Это просто ретушь фото с ручной доработкой. Ищите в этом направлении уроки.
    Можно найти схожие экшены/фильтры для придания одинаковой цветовой гаммы, но ручную доводку резкости или частичное размытие, дорисовку/перерисовку деталей и т. п. они не сделают.
    Ответ написан
    Комментировать
  • Обьясните новичку как происходит перенос домена!?

    CityCat4
    @CityCat4
    Внимание! Изменился адрес почты!
    Для того чтобы на специализированных сайтах,когда пробиваешь информацию о домене, не писало РУ и питерский номер Бегета.

    Открой уже для себя whois, блин.
    Ответ написан
    Комментировать
  • Как сделать маску ввода номера авто?

    saboteur_kiev
    @saboteur_kiev
    software engineer
    регулярку используйте
    [A-Z] \d{3} [A-Z]{2} \d{2,3}
    Ответ написан
    5 комментариев
  • Собрать пк или playstation 5?

    vabka
    @vabka
    Токсичный шарпист
    В теории god of war на rx580 работать должен.
    Xeon с Али тоже должен быть производительней, чем i5 2500, который рекомендуется для gow.

    Ps5 гарантированно потянет даже новинки

    Вопрос остаётся в количестве необходимого пердолинга и цене владения.
    Если брать только для игр
    Ответ написан
    2 комментария
  • Как реализовать бэкап сайта/бд посредством PHP?

    Stalker_RED
    @Stalker_RED
    Возможно, хотя непонятно зачем это делать на PHP.

    Достаточно одной команды архиватору - вот эту папку заархивируй, добавь в название дату, и помести вон в ту папку. Или отправь по почте, например.
    Ну и в планировщик задач это добавить.

    А вообще для бекапа есть специаллизированный софт, который не только позволит бекапить, но и разворачивать из бекапа обратно с минимальными усилиями.

    Еще лучше, если у вас будет запасной сайт, на который можно переключиться за секунды. Но это уже история следующего уровня.
    Ответ написан
    Комментировать
  • Тестер пропускной способности сетей (меди) по приемлемой цене. Есть в природе?

    @mordo445
    тестер пропускной способности сети недорого это iperf3.exe, а если вам нужен квалифаер/сертифаер для СКС, то готовьте деньги. Например,или вот, но эти без отчетов. За отчеты придется накинуть пару тысяч как за вот этот, но его я не использовал, внимательнее перед заказом.
    Ответ написан
    1 комментарий
  • Как восстановить Windows 10 с помощью Media Creation Tool без диска восстановления?

    @Drno
    Для того чтобы восстановить винду с загр диска надо с него запуститься. Можно скачать ISO образ винды и записать rufus, можно нажать 1 кнопку в media creation и он сделает тоже самое...
    дальше уже исходя из проблемы, возможно и хватит стандартных средств чтобы восстановить систему, смотря что не так...
    Ответ написан
    Комментировать
  • Как на компьютере с Windows XP открыть шару с сервера 2019?

    SignFinder
    @SignFinder
    Wintel\Unix Engineer\DevOps
    Видимо политики нового домена разрешают другой набор шифров и сервер и клиенты не могут договориться между собой.
    Вообще такие вещи по логам evetnvwr диагностируются.
    Ответ написан
    2 комментария
  • Нормальная ли практика делать сайт на разных языках в поддоменах?

    delphinpro
    @delphinpro
    frontend developer
    Мультиязычность (контента) обычно реализуется двумя методами
    1. Отдельные колонки под языки в каждой таблице.
    2. Отдельные таблицы одноименных моделей под каждый язык.
    Для реализации обоих способов есть уже несколько готовых пакетов.
    https://yandex.ru/search/?text=laravel+multilangua...

    А уж какую адресацию вы сделаете, особой роли не играет. Это могут быть и поддомены (en.site.ru), и поддиректории (site.ru/en).

    Я сейчас говорю о переводах именно контента. С переводом интерфейса проблем нет, тут используется встроенные методы локализации.
    Ответ написан
  • Как можно настроить предпросмотр фото в проводнике Ubuntu?

    smorman
    @smorman
    When In Rome do as The Romans do...
    Если речь о Nautilus (Файлы) то ищите плагин для него в файловом хранилище Canonical (можно через поиск в Synaptic найти, забив nautilus и из перечня плагинов, прочитав описание, выбрать нужный и установить).
    Такой плагин есть.

    После установки предпросмотр будет работать при условии, что для вашей версии Nautilus-а есть таковой.
    Не помню просто название плагина...

    Одни вспомнил - Globus
    Ответ написан
    3 комментария
  • Домен покупают или арендуют?

    @AUser0
    Чем больше знаю, тем лучше понимаю, как мало знаю.
    При размещении сайта силами хостинговой компании частенько хостеры предлагают "помочь" в покупке доменного имени, либо просто "дарят" клиенту нужное доменное имя. Так вот это тот случай и есть. При регистрации доменного имени через таких "добрых" посредников-хостеров все права на доменное имя переходят самим посредникам. То есть вы платите хостерам за домен, они его регистрируют на себя, делают поддержку DNS, привязывают к своему серверу (где будет физически работать сайт), и вуаля. Считается, что вы владеете доменным именем, но это только аренда. Попытайтесь уйти от хостера вместе с доменным именем - узнаете этот "сюрприз". По крайней мере лет 15 назад дело обстояло так.
    Ответ написан
    Комментировать
  • Где посмотреть реестр всех доменов интернета?

    CityCat4
    @CityCat4
    Внимание! Изменился адрес почты!
    Нигде. Нет его.

    У каждого техрегистратора есть список своих доменов, которые на данный момент зарегистрированы (и вовсе не факт, что они к чему-то привязаны). Но он им не поделится. Доменное имя, которое не зарегистрировано - не существует. Как обьект права, оно возникает тогда, когда ты его регистрируешь в рамках своего договора с регистратором. И исчезает, когда ты теряешь на него права.
    Ответ написан
    4 комментария
  • С помощью какого инструмента можно сверстать то что на картинке?

    Ankhena
    @Ankhena Куратор тега CSS
    Нежно люблю верстку
    Ответ написан
    Комментировать
  • Как найти 3 самых частых символа в строке?

    0xD34F
    @0xD34F
    from collections import Counter
    
    count = Counter(s)
    sorted_count = sorted(count.items(), key=lambda n: n[1], reverse=True)
    
    for n in sorted_count[:3]:
      print(f'"{n[0]}" - {n[1]}')
    Ответ написан
    1 комментарий